		<description><![CDATA[TROY Group, Inc., a Worldwide Provider in Secure Output Solutions, announces the TROY 3015 Security Printers, the latest addition to TROY&#8217;s line of Security Printers. Designed and manufactured under partnership and agreement with HP, TROY 3015 Security Printers include integrated paper tray locks and steel shielding to prevent the paper theft risk common to standard [...]]]></description>
